Title :
Control of uncertain chaotic systems with improved performance using modified adaptive backstepping and genetic algorithms

Abstract :
We propose a modification of the traditional adaptive backstepping method which leads to substantially less control effort in the problem of adaptive chaos control. Our technique, which is applicable to all systems that exhibit chaotic behaviour and can be rendered into parametric strict feedback form, is based on an introduced invariance principle extension and employs genetic algorithms to optimise the controller parameters. Simulations with the Chua´s system are conducted to show the effectiveness of the approach.
